Police blotter
CRIMINAL DAMAGE TO PROPERTY -- A concrete drinking fountain belonging to the city of Salina in the 100 block of North Santa Fe Avenue was damaged between 5 p.m. Monday and 7:22 a.m. Tuesday; $1,000 damage.
THEFT -- A PlayStation 3 and five games belonging to Nicholas D. Cassel were stolen from 756 Osage between 6:45 and 8 p.m. Tuesday; $650 loss.
BURGLARY -- A silver DVD player and 50 DVDs belonging to Travis W. Rathbun were stolen from 504 Anderson between 8 a.m. and 5 p.m. Tuesday; $600 loss.
n A Sony DVD player, cash, jewelry and a 37-inch LCD Vizio flat screen television belonging to Betty J. Wiegert were stolen from 443 Yale between 2:15 and 8:15 p.m. Tuesday; $1,870 loss.
INJURY CRASH -- Emily N. Verhoeff, 27, 801 N. Santa Fe No. A, was treated at Salina Regional Health Center after her car and a pickup truck driven by Michael A. Swanson, 16, Assaria, collided at the intersection of South Ohio and East Crawford streets at 1:04 p.m. Tuesday.
